Three hurt in crash near Colby
1/15/2009
COLBY — Three Winona youths were injured in a crash Wednesday south of Colby on Kansas Highway 25.
A Ford Taurus driven by Rachael A. Smith, 17, Winona, was southbound 16 miles south of Colby on K-25 about 8:30 p.m. Wednesday when it went into the west ditch and hit a culvert. The car became airborne and landed on its wheels on an access road, according to a Kansas Highway Patrol report.
Smith was injured, as were passengers Rebecca Smith, 16, and Heather Martin, 16, both of Winona.
Rachael Smith was taken to Logan County Hospital, where her condition is unknown. Rebecca Smith and Martin were taken to Citizens Medical Center in Colby, where both were reported in fair condition Thursday morning.
According to the report, a fourth passenger, Seth Smith, 12, Winona, might have been injured but was not taken to a hospital.
Rachael Smith and Martin were wearing seat belts, and Rebecca Smith was not, according to the report. It is unknown whether Seth Smith was wearing a seat belt.
